Asparagus Salad

Fat 52%Carbs 36%Protein 13%
Percent Calories

1 serving of asparagus salad contains 330 Calories. The macronutrient breakdown is 36% carbs, 52% fat, and 13% protein. This is a good source of protein (20% of your Daily Value), fiber (41% of your Daily Value), and potassium (21% of your Daily Value).

Directions

  1. Cover the cherry tomatoes with balsamic vinegar before roasting on a non-stick tray for 25mins at 170c.
  2. Meanwhile, heat a griddle pan over medium heat.
  3. Spray the aubergine slices and asparagus with olive oil spray, and fry for 12 mins. Regularly turning the aubergine and asparagus. Once the ingredients have a charred edge, place this pan on a bottom shelf of the oven and cook alongside the tomatoes.
  4. Once the tomatoes have been cooking for 25mins, add the spinach to the tray and cook for a further 5mins until wilted.
  5. Serve the tomato and spinach mix into bowls, before topping with asparagus, aubergine and sprinkles of sunflower seeds.
